AI-Powered Bookkeeping

Transaction Categorization

AI transforms manual transaction coding into an automated, learning system.

AI TRANSACTION CATEGORIZATION:

HOW IT WORKS:
├── Bank feed imports transactions
├── AI analyzes:
│   ├── Merchant name
│   ├── Transaction description
│   ├── Amount patterns
│   ├── Historical coding
│   ├── Industry context
│   └── Similar client patterns
├── AI suggests category
├── Accountant reviews/approves
├── AI learns from corrections
└── Accuracy improves over time

ACCURACY PROGRESSION:
Month 1: 70-80% correct categorization
Month 3: 85-90% correct
Month 6: 92-97% correct
Ongoing: 95%+ with minimal corrections

EXAMPLE:
Transaction: "AMZN MKTP US*2X4Y7Z8"

AI Analysis:
├── Vendor: Amazon
├── Pattern: Similar to past office supplies
├── Amount: $47.52 (typical supplies range)
├── Day of week: Tuesday (business day)
├── Suggestion: Office Supplies
├── Confidence: 94%
└── Status: Auto-coded (high confidence)

Receipt and Invoice Processing

AI DOCUMENT PROCESSING:

RECEIPT PROCESSING:
├── Photo/scan upload
├── AI extracts:
│   ├── Vendor name
│   ├── Date
│   ├── Amount
│   ├── Tax breakdown
│   ├── Payment method
│   └── Line items
├── Auto-categorize
├── Match to bank transaction
├── Attach to expense record
└── Route for approval

INVOICE PROCESSING (AP):
├── Invoice received (email/upload)
├── AI extracts:
│   ├── Vendor details
│   ├── Invoice number
│   ├── Date and due date
│   ├── Line items
│   ├── GL coding suggestions
│   ├── Tax amounts
│   └── Payment terms
├── Match to PO if applicable
├── Flag discrepancies
├── Route for approval
└── Schedule payment

ACCURACY:
├── Data extraction: 95%+ accurate
├── Coding suggestions: 90%+ accurate
├── Exception rate: <10% need manual review
└── Processing time: Seconds vs. minutes

PLATFORMS:
├── Dext (Hubdoc) - receipt capture
├── BILL - invoice processing
├── Vic.ai - enterprise AP
├── Tipalti - global payments
└── Stampli - AP collaboration
Pro Tip: Set up approval workflows by amount threshold. Have AI auto-approve routine transactions under $500 while flagging larger or unusual items for human review. This balances efficiency with control.

AI Financial Analysis

Automated Variance Analysis

AI VARIANCE ANALYSIS:

TRADITIONAL PROCESS:
├── Pull budget and actual data
├── Calculate variances manually
├── Identify significant items
├── Research root causes
├── Write explanations
└── Time: 4-8 hours monthly

AI-ASSISTED PROCESS:
├── Data pulled automatically
├── Variances calculated instantly
├── AI identifies significant items
├── AI suggests root causes
├── AI drafts explanations
├── Human reviews and refines
└── Time: 30-60 minutes monthly

AI ANALYSIS OUTPUT:

Revenue Variance: -$45,000 (-8.5%)

AI Analysis:
├── Primary drivers identified:
│   ├── Product A sales down $32K (3 key accounts)
│   ├── Service revenue down $18K
│   ├── Product B up $5K (new customers)
│
├── Likely causes:
│   ├── Q4 seasonality (historical pattern)
│   ├── Key account ABC reduced orders 40%
│   ├── Implementation delays on 2 projects
│
├── Suggested narrative:
│   "Revenue declined $45K (8.5%) vs budget,
│   primarily driven by reduced orders from
│   key account ABC (-$25K) and Q4 seasonal
│   patterns consistent with prior years.
│   Service revenue timing delays of $18K
│   expected to recover in Q1."
│
└── Recommended actions:
    ├── Review ABC account relationship
    ├── Accelerate Q1 implementations
    └── Monitor seasonal recovery

Tax and Compliance AI

Tax Preparation Automation

AI TAX PREPARATION:

DATA GATHERING:
├── Client portal with AI assistant
├── Document upload and extraction
├── Prior year data import
├── Third-party data integration
├── Missing document identification
└── Client questionnaire with smart follow-ups

AI ASSISTANCE:
├── K-1 data extraction
├── 1099 compilation
├── Investment transaction import
├── Rental property calculations
├── Business expense categorization
├── Depreciation schedules
└── Form population

REVIEW AND QC:
├── Cross-reference verification
├── Prior year comparison
├── Anomaly detection
├── Missing item alerts
├── Error checking
├── Audit risk assessment

EXAMPLE WORKFLOW:

Client uploads documents
        │
        ▼
AI extracts data:
├── W-2: Income $145,000, withholding $28,000
├── 1099-INT: Bank interest $1,234
├── 1099-DIV: Qualified dividends $5,678
├── Mortgage statement: Interest $18,456
├── Property tax bill: $8,234
└── 27 investment transactions from 1099-B
        │
        ▼
AI populates forms:
├── Form 1040 drafted
├── Schedule A vs. Standard deduction compared
├── Schedule D with gain/loss summary
├── State return prepared
└── Estimated payments calculated
        │
        ▼
Review flags:
├── "Charitable giving down 40% - verify"
├── "New 1099-K detected - business income?"
├── "State withholding appears low"
└── "Investment loss harvesting opportunity"
        │
        ▼
CPA reviews and finalizes

Compliance Monitoring

AI COMPLIANCE MONITORING:

CONTINUOUS MONITORING:
├── Transaction scanning
├── Regulatory change tracking
├── Deadline management
├── Document retention
├── Audit trail maintenance
└── Risk assessment

ALERTS AND FLAGS:
├── Large/unusual transactions
├── Related party transactions
├── Potential compliance violations
├── Missing documentation
├── Approaching deadlines
└── Regulatory changes affecting client

EXAMPLE:

AI Alert: "Related Party Transaction Detected"

Details:
├── Transaction: $50,000 payment to ABC LLC
├── ABC LLC ownership matches client principal
├── Requires: Form 1099-NEC consideration
├── Requires: Documentation of arm's length pricing
├── Requires: Potential 267 timing issues
├── Action: Flag for manager review
└── Priority: High

AI Recommendation:
"Document business purpose, ensure fair market
value pricing, and verify timing for deduction.
Consider obtaining independent appraisal if
significant recurring transactions."

Frequently Asked Questions

Will AI replace accountants?

AI will not replace accountants but will transform the profession. Routine tasks like data entry and reconciliation will be automated, freeing accountants to focus on advisory services, complex problem-solving, and client relationships—work that requires human judgment and expertise.

Is AI accurate enough for financial work?

Modern AI achieves 95%+ accuracy on routine tasks like transaction categorization and document extraction. For complex judgments, AI assists but doesn't replace human review. The key is implementing proper quality control—AI handles volume while humans ensure accuracy on exceptions.

How do I protect client data with AI?

Use only enterprise AI solutions with proper security certifications (SOC 2, etc.). Ensure vendors don't train on your data. Implement access controls and audit trails. Never use consumer AI tools with client financial data.

Where should an accounting firm start with AI?

Start with document processing and transaction categorization—high volume, relatively low risk. Then expand to variance analysis and reporting. Build comfort and processes before moving to more complex tax and advisory applications.

How will AI affect my staff?

AI elevates staff from manual data entry to higher-value work. Junior staff can focus on analysis rather than data input. Train staff to work with AI as a productivity multiplier, not a replacement. The most successful firms are retraining staff for advisory roles.
